о каждом виде спорта, с максимальной и минимальной суммами по абонементам;
+Для каждого персональный запрос по общей работе.
Часть 2.
Построить запросы:
запрос, показывающий всех тренеров и их данные с суммой абонемента большей, чем средняя сумма абонемента за выбранный месяц;
+Для каждого персональный запрос по общей работе.
Часть3.
3.1Создать дополнительную таблицу Доходы, показывающую по каждому тренеру доход за вид спорта по каждому месяцу (используя команды create table, insert, update, alter table
3.2) Написать триггер, контролирующие невозможность внесения в таблицу «Абонементы» количества занятий <=4.
3.3) Написать процедуру, выдающую по параметру “фамилия тренера”, результаты его подопечных.
аписать функцию, возвращающую за указанный период таблицу видов спорта и стоимости занятий по ним.
+Для каждого персональный запрос по общей работе.
Часть 4. Индивидуальное задание.
Построить проект схему БД. Продумать ограничения, написать триггер. Наполнить данными. Продемонстрировать выборку данных по заданным условиям(3 запроса по аналогии с общим заданием с использованием представлений, функций, процедур).
Темы работ:
1. База учебного заведения с сотрудниками, учащимися, учебными планами, журналами, мероприятиями.()
2. Футбольная база с информацией об игроках, командах, тренерах, болельщиках, матчах, клубах.(Серюбина)
3. База фильмов, студий, режиссеров, актеров, продюссеров, студий, проката.(Рыльский)
4. База лечебного учреждения со специалистами и сотрудниками, пациентами, характеристиками и видами услуг, платежами.(Русина)
5. База транспортной компании с видами транспорта, работниками, владельцами, заказчиками, заказами, платежами.()
6. База данных торговой сети с предприятиями, сотрудниками, клиентами, поставщиками, товарами, услугами, платежами.(Иванов)
7. База метеорологических наблюдений со станциями, оборудованием, видами наблюдений, результатами, сотрудниками, журналами.(Чеботарева)
8. База банковского учреждения с сотрудниками, клиентами, услугами, платежами, валютами.(Ковшарев)
9. База производственного предприятия с материалами, оборудованием, технологиями, произведенной продукцией, работниками.()
10. База природного парка с территориями, флорой, фауной, климатом, сотрудниками, охраняемыми объектами.(Пряничников)
11. База археологических данных с местом хранения, названиями экспонатов, экспедиций, мест экспедиций, сотрудников, исторических характеристик.(Зобнина)
12. База данных почтовой службы с сотрудниками, видами услуг, адресатами, адресами, стоимостью, контролем.()
13. База данных спортивного комплекса с тренерами, посетителями, видами услуг, расписанием, платежами и контролем.Мазина
14. База данных ГАИ с сотрудниками, владельцами автотранспорта, автотранспортом, учетом, нарушениями и штрафами, платежами.(Шалай)
15. База данных библиотеки с сотрудниками, читателями, видами услуг, фондами, регистрацией заказов, контролем.(Новгородова)
16. База данных адресное бюро с жителями, улицами, домами, регистрацией проживания, сотрудниками, запросами, заказчиками.()
17. База хоккейной лиги с указанием информации о клубах, командах, игроках, тренерах, контрактах, играх, забитых шайбах и авторах.
18. База выставки животных с информацией о хозяевах, питомцах, породах, результатах проходов в своих категориях и полученных оценках.Лобанова
19. База данных о предоставлений вакансий на работу, какие вакансии, какие требования, сколько вакансий. Кто ищет, кто предлагает, контакты. Информация о состоявшихся контрактах.Банных
20. База метеонаблюдений, где, кто, что, характеристика, когда.
21. База продажи авиабилетов. № рейса, пункт отправления, пункт назначения, дата отправления и время, компания, дата продажи, пассажир, сумма, касса или агентство. Бандура
Рекомендуемая литература (основная):
Диго С.М. Бзы данных.Проектирование и использование. Учебник- М.: Финансы и статистика.2005.
Дейт К.Дж. Введение в системы баз данных.- М: Вильямс, 2005, 8-ое изд.- 1328 с.
Хомоненко А.Д. Базы данных: Учебник для вузов, СПб., Корона принт, 2006.[7]
Советов Б.Я., Цехановский В.В., Чертовский В.Д. Базы данных. Теория и практика. Учебник для вузов. М.: Высшая школа., 2005, 463с.
Гектор Гарсиа-Молина, Джеффри.Д.Ульман, Дженнифер Уидом Системы баз данных. Полный курс. М.: Вильямс., 2003, 1082с.
Глушаков С.В., Ломотько Д.В. Базы данных: Учебный курс. – Харьков: Фолио; М.: ООО «Издательство АСТ», 2000.
Ревунков Г.И., Базы и банки данных знаний. Учебник для вузов, М., Высш. шк., 1992. [6]
Чери С., Готлоб Г, Танка Л. Логическое программирование и базы данных.- М.: Мир, 1992.- 352 с. [1]
Рекомендуемая литература (дополнительная):
Архипенков С. Я. Хранилища данных: От концепции до внедрения / С. Я. Архипенков, Д. В. Голубев, О. Б. Максименко; Под ред. С. Архипенкова. - М.: Диалог-МИФИ, 2002. - 528 с.: ил. - Библиогр.: с. 525 (19 назв.). - ISBN 5-86404-167-X. [1]
Михеев Р.Н. MS SQL Server 2005 для администраторов. СПб.: БВХ-Петербург, 2006.- 544с.
Мамаев Е. Microsoft SQL Server 2000. Спб. 2003.[1]
Ребекка М. Риордан «Программирование в SQL Server 2000».[4]
Малкольм Г. Программирование для Microsoft SQL Server 2000 с использованием XML./Пер. с англ.- М.: Издательско-торговый дом «Русская редакция», 2002, 320 с.:илл.[1]
Мак-Маус Д.П., Гольдштейн Д., Прайс К.Т. Обработка баз данных на Visual Basic.Net, М., 2003[3]
Гофман В.Э., Хомоненко А.Д. Работа с базами данных в DELPHI – 2-е изд. –СПб.: БХВ-Петербург, 2003.- 624 с.: илл..
Архипенков С.Я. Аналитические системы на базе Oracle Express Olap. М., Диалог-Мифи, 2000.
Лугачев М.И. и др. Экономическая информатика: Введение в экономический анализ. Учебник. –М.: ИНФРА-М, 2005.- 958с.
СУБД ORACLE и ее сетевые приложения. М., Россия, 1993.
Архипенков С. Я. От переработки данных к анализу//Банковские технологии» 1998.
Марков А.С. Информационная технология по стандартам ИСО.- М.: Финансы и статистика, 2000-382 с.
Заморин А.П., Марков А.С. Толковый словарь по вычислительной технике и программированию (Ред. Шура-Бура М.Р.). -М.: Русский язык, 1988.- 221 с.
Першиков В.И., Марков А.С., Савинков В.М. Русско-английский толковый словарь по информатике (3-е издание).- М.: Финансы и статистика, 1999.363 с.
Клайн К. SQL. Справочник 2-ое изд.